UiPath Documentation
activities
latest
false
Importante :
Este contenido se ha localizado parcialmente a partir de un sistema de traducción automática. La localización de contenidos recién publicados puede tardar entre una y dos semanas en estar disponible.

Actividades de integraciones clásicas

Última actualización 20 de may. de 2026

Ámbito de Slack

UiPath.Slack.Activities.SlackScopeActivity

Información general

La actividad de SlackScope sigue el protocolo OAuth 2.0 para establecer una conexión autenticada entre UiPath y la API de Slack.

Antes de que la actividad Ámbito de Slack pueda establecer una conexión, necesita autorización para tomar medidas en tu nombre y acceder a tus datos permitidos. Para conceder autorización, crea e instala una nueva aplicación de Slack en tu espacio de trabajo (no se requiere codificación). No necesitas distribuir públicamente esta aplicación a través del Directorio de aplicaciones de Slack, solo necesitas instalarla en el espacio de trabajo que deseas automatizar.

Al crear la aplicación, asignas los ámbitos (es decir, permisos) para definir los métodos de la API que la aplicación (y posteriormente las actividades) puede llamar y la información a la que puede acceder.

  • Para obtener instrucciones paso a paso sobre cómo añadir ámbitos, consulta Añadir permisos de aplicación en la guía de Configuración .
  • Para obtener una lista completa de los ámbitos necesarios para este paquete de actividades, consulta Ámbitos a añadir en la guía de Configuración .

After registering the app, Slack assigns a unique Client ID (ClientID), Client Secret (ClientSecret), and OAuth Access Token (Token) that you enter in the Slack Scope activity to initiate a connection.

Cómo funciona

Los siguientes pasos y diagrama de secuencia de mensajes son un ejemplo de cómo funciona la actividad desde el momento de diseño (es decir, las dependencias de la actividad y las propiedades de entrada / salida) hasta el tiempo de ejecución.

  1. Completa los pasos de configuración .

  2. Añade la actividad Ámbito de Slack a tu proyecto.

  3. Introduce valores para las propiedades Autenticación (atendida) y Autenticación (unattended) .

En el cuerpo de la actividad

The Slack Scope activity has two different authentication models depending on the automation mode (unattended or attended).

There are two differences between unattended and attended automation as it pertains to Slack Scope activity: scope setting requirements and allowing access.

Requisitos de configuración del ámbito

Como se indica en la sección Añadir permisos de aplicación de la guía Configuración , si planeas ejecutar automatización unattended, debes establecer los ámbitos utilizando la configuración de la característica OAuth y Permisos de la aplicación.

Si deseas ejecutar la automatización attended, no tienes que establecer los ámbitos utilizando la configuración de la característica AutenticaciónO y Permisos de la aplicación (puedes), sino que debes establecer los ámbitos utilizando la propiedad Ámbitos (descrita a continuación).

To enable the best user experience when using the activities, it's recommended that you set the using the app's OAuth & Permissions feature settings (as described in the Setup guide). By setting the scopes ahead a time, you can freely switch between unattended and attended automation when you're building and running your project.

Permitiendo acceso

When the Slack Scope activity runs during attended automation, a web page opens that prompts you to grant your app access to your selected scopes by clicking an Allow button.

Durante la automatización desatendida, se otorga acceso silencioso a su aplicación en segundo plano (no se requiere ninguna acción del usuario).

  • ClientID - The unique ID assigned to your app by Slack. Enter a String value.
    • Esta propiedad solo acepta el valor String de su ID de cliente. No admite variables String .
    • To find your Client ID, go to your created app's Basic Information page. Under App Credentials you'll see both your Client ID and Client Secret.
  • ClientSecret - The unique ID associated with your ClientID. Enter a String value.
    • Esta propiedad solo acepta el valor String de su secreto de cliente. No admite variables String .
    • To find your Client Secret, go to your app's Basic Information page. Under App Credentials you'll see both your Client ID and Client Secret.
  • Token - The app's OAuth Access Token to use for unattended automation only. Slack automatically generates this token when you install the app to your workspace. Enter a String value. This property only accepts the String value of your OAuth Access Token. It does not support String variables.
    • To get your OAuth Access Token, you must first install the app to your workspace. After installing your app, go to your app's Installed App Settings page (image shown above).
    • Para obtener más información, consulta Instalar tu aplicación en tu espacio de trabajo en la guía de configuración.

Propiedades

Autenticación

  • Scopes - A categorized list of the scopes to grant (or previously granted when following the Setup guide) to the app. Select all the applicable scopes. There are 7 scopes: PublicChannels, PrivateChannels, DirectMessages, GroupMessages, Users, Chat, Files.
    • Para obtener una lista completa de ámbitos y su asignación a las actividades y los valores permitidos anteriores, consulta Ámbitos para añadir en la guía de Configuración .

Común

  • DisplayName - The display name of the activity. This field supports only Strings or String variables.

Otros

  • Privado : si se selecciona, los valores de variables y argumentos ya no se registran en el nivel Detallado.
  • ReportApiErrorAsException - When selected, API error responses are reported in BusinessActivityExecutionException by all child activities that use this application scope. When cleared, the child activity populates the API error message in the ResponseStatus output property and workflow execution continues. Check the ResponseStatus property to confirm successful execution.

Salida

  • Connection - The connection which can be passed to a child application scope. This field supports only Connection variables.

Ejemplo

La siguiente imagen muestra un ejemplo de la relación de dependencia de la actividad y los valores de las propiedades de entrada / salida.

Para obtener instrucciones paso a paso y ejemplos, consulta las guías de inicio rápido .

¿Te ha resultado útil esta página?

Conectar

¿Necesita ayuda? Soporte

¿Quiere aprender? UiPath Academy

¿Tiene alguna pregunta? Foro de UiPath

Manténgase actualizado